During an A/C performance check, we'll determine the condition of your 2009 Ford E-350 Super Duty A/C system to evaluate what repairs are necessary (if any). This check includes a visual inspection, performance test, and pressure and leak test. If we think there might be a leak, we'll run a special U/V dye through the system or use a "sniffer." A “sniffer” isn’t a technician with a good nose! It’s a machine that’s used on different parts of your Ford E-350 Super Duty A/C system to identify points where refrigerant fumes could be escaping the system. If your A/C system has a leak, we’ll find and repair it.

E-350 Super Duty A/C Recharge

While your 2009 Ford E-350 Super Duty’s air conditioner is being serviced, we’ll also do an A/C evacuation and recharge. During this process, a technician will remove the old refrigerant from the A/C system. Then, they’ll perform an evacuation (also known as a discharge) on the entire system per Ford guidelines. Finally, we’ll recharge the A/C system with new refrigerant and after one final test to be sure the system is cooling properly, you’re all set. Other Ford E-350 Super Duty A/C Problems

Warm air isn't the only Ford E-350 Super Duty A/C problem you may encounter. Another common A/C problem is weak airflow, which could be caused by mold or mildew buildup, a loose hose, an old ventilation fan, or a compromised seal. If you notice that your A/C system’s air is cold at first, then quickly goes warm, this can mean there’s a malfunctioning compressor clutch, a leak, or a blown fuse. Are you breathing in some “interesting” new odors in your 2009 Ford E-350 Super Duty? That could be the result of a dirty cabin air filter (an easy fix!) or a moldy evaporator case.   • Why do I get hot air from my E-350 Super Duty A/C? Maybe your A/C starts cool but then gets warm. Or maybe it never gets cold in the first place. Either way, your A/C troubles could be traced back to a clogged expansion valve, faulty compressor clutch, blown fuse, or leak.
  • What can cause an A/C system leak? To put it simply, age and moisture are some of the main causes of leaks in your A/C. Over time, rubber gaskets and seals can wear out, which pushes much-needed refrigerant out of your E-350 Super Duty’s A/C system — and lets outside moisture get in, which can take a toll on internal A/C components.
  • Does my E-350 Super Duty A/C run on gas? Your E-350 Super Duty’s A/C uses some power from the engine to run. So, while your air conditioning system may not directly use gasoline as a fuel source, using the A/C can indirectly affect your vehicle’s fuel efficiency.
  • My E-350 Super Duty’s A/C smells like vinegar! What can cause that? It’s easy for moisture to accumulate in your car’s air conditioning system, which can cause microorganisms like bacteria to grow. In turn, this bacteria growth can cause the A/C in your E-350 Super Duty to produce a vinegary odor.
  • Why does my vehicle have to be moving for my E-350 Super Duty’s A/C to work? There could be issues with one or more components in the air conditioning or electrical system. Your E-350 Super Duty may have a faulty cooling fan or low refrigerant.
